**Mgmt Meeting Minutes — Retiring the Brightline Range**

Quick recap for sales leads at Fenholt Supplies: we agreed to retire the Brightline fixture range by year-end. Remaining stock moves to clearance pricing next month, and accounts on standing orders get migrated to the Lumetta range. Trade-in incentives were approved in principle. The confidential note on next steps sits just below.

board note of bajof-bajeg: The pricing group signed off on a budget of $13.4 million for Project Sildor. The renewal with Lamixek Holdings closes at $48.9 million a year, 49 percent above the last contract.

# Break-Glass: Catalog Cache Invalidation

Scope: the Pinrow product catalog at Veldstone Retail. If stale prices persist after a purge and the Hollowmere invalidation queue is wedged, use break-glass to flush the edge tier directly. Contractors: get verbal sign-off from the catalog lead first. Steps: open the Hollowmere admin shell, select emergency-flush, confirm the tenant, and run it once — repeated flushes thrash the origin. Access is logged and expires after 20 minutes. Unseal the admin shell with the passphrase below.

recovery phrase for kahop-tajog: istix-casvan

To the release manager: I'm passing ownership of the Pellwick deep-link router to Sorrel before the 4.2 cut. The intent-matching table now lives in the Farrowgate config service; stale entries were purged last sprint. Watch the fallback route — it silently swallows malformed slugs, which inflated our drop-off metrics in March. The staging resolver needs its keystore unlocked before each regression pass, and that keystore accepts only one credential. For the signing vault, the recovery phrase is noted directly below.

recovery phrase for tafog-fafog: novix-novdor-fraath-brieth-olieth-oliix-rusix-wenion-julax-druox

**Q: When is the Cloverpipe broker upgrade happening?**

A: The upgrade to Cloverpipe 4 rolls out per-cluster over two weeks, starting with staging. Consumers need no changes unless they use deprecated fan-out topics. Expect brief rebalancing pauses, no message loss. The rollout schedule and rollback criteria are documented on the internal page here.

wiki page, fahaf-yagag: https://confluence.qorvellabs.internal/pages/display/pages/display